[Ingrid Lunden for TechCrunch][1]:

> Domain registration and hosting company GoDaddy is continuing on its acquisitions roll, with the announcement today that it acquired Media Temple, a premium domain hosting and website services company based out of Los Angeles that targets website development professionals. Financial terms are not being disclosed.

[From the Media Temple FAQ on the acquisition][2]:

> **Will you be sharing my personal & financial information with GoDaddy?**
> Your personal and financial information stays securely in our system. No third-party vendors will ever have access to it, which has always been our practice.

Translation: yes.

Media Temple *used* to be such a great company.
